Jeffrey Johnson (Maine)
Jeffrey Johnson is a Democratic candidate for District 3 of the Maine State Senate. The primary election took place on June 12, 2018. The general election is being held on November 6, 2018.[1]

General election
Elections for the Maine State Senate took place in 2018. The closed primary election took place on June 12, 2018, and the general election was held on November 6, 2018. The major party candidate filing deadline was March 15, 2018, and the third-party and independent candidate filing deadline was June 1, 2018.[2] Jeffrey Johnson (D) and Bradlee Farrin (R) are running in the Maine State Senate District 3 general election.

Democratic primary election
Jeffrey Johnson ran unopposed in the Maine State Senate District 3 Democratic primary election.[1]

Republican primary election
Bradlee Farrin ran unopposed in the Maine State Senate District 3 Republican primary election.[1]
